Two children died in a residential fire in Kekava municipality
Photo: LETA

On Friday morning, as a result of a fire in a residential building in the village of Krustkalni in Kekava municipality, two people died, 29 people were rescued, several were injured, and 15 evacuated themselves, the State Fire and Rescue Service (SFRS) reported to the LETA agency.

The Emergency Medical Service confirmed to the LETA agency that minors have died. The fire occurred in a building at 5 Jaunlazdu Street.

At 4:59 AM, the State Fire and Rescue Service (SFRS) received information about a fire in an apartment on the first floor of a four-story residential building in Kekava municipality. Firefighters arrived on the scene and found that open flames were rapidly spreading through the floors of the building. The firefighters immediately began searching all apartments and rescuing people.

From the burning building, firefighters rescued 29 people, of whom 18 were in rescue masks, six were assisted with aerial ladders, and five more were rescued using a three-stage extension ladder.

Emergency medical assistance was required for seven individuals: four injured were hospitalized, while three did not require hospitalization.

As a result of the fire, two people died. An additional 15 people evacuated from the building on their own.

On Friday morning, firefighters continue to work at the scene - structural demolition is underway.

The Kekava municipality informed the LETA agency that a crisis management group meeting will be held on Friday morning in connection with the incident, during which necessary assistance for the victims will be discussed.
